A reader can make predictions in a given text about what would happen next based on the available clues or hints by the author and characters.
However, if this prediction is incorrect, it usually means that the author cleverly masked his intentions and led the readers down a blind alley, and wants to make the book more difficult to predict.
This is usually the case with suspense-based novels
<h3>What is Prediction in a Text?</h3>
This refers to the reading strategy that is used by readers to make inferences about what would happen next in a story, based on available evidence.
